Why lighting matters
Purposeful lighting affects mood, circulation and perceived value. Modern installations combine smart chandeliers, micro‑environment zoning and app‑driven scenes to create reflective retail moments. Deep ideas are available in Lighting That Remembers.
Implementation tactics
- Map high‑value zones and apply warm, focused scenes to product displays.
- Run event‑based lighting sequences for micro‑drops and weekend activations; coordinate with pop‑up operators following weekend maker pop‑up strategies.
- Leverage hybrid chandeliers as both light source and brand signal.
Measurement
Use short A/B experiments tied to time‑on‑site and POS conversion rates. Combine lighting changes with local events to see compound lifts in conversion.
Final recommendation
Malls that treat lighting as a programmable marketing channel will create more meaningful retail circuits and increase both tenant retention and store revenue.
